How to Run an Effective Speed Test

Conducting a speed test Google Wifi requires a specific approach to ensure accuracy. You should test both near the primary unit and in the furthest corners of your home where buffering usually occurs. Use multiple devices and different times of day to gauge peak performance. The goal is to identify specific locations that suffer from high latency or low throughput, allowing you to reposition nodes strategically.

Connect your test device directly to the node via Ethernet for the most accurate baseline measurement.

Run the test wirelessly to measure the real-world performance of your mesh network.

Test during various times to observe congestion patterns during evening hours.

Compare results against your ISP’s advertised speeds to identify bottlenecks.

Interpreting the Data: More Than Just Mbps

When you analyze a speed test Google Wifi result, you are looking for more than just a high number. While megabits per second (Mbps) indicate raw throughput, latency (ping) is crucial for gaming and video calls. A stable connection with low jitter is often more valuable than a burst of speed that fluctuates. Use the data to determine if you are experiencing packet loss or inconsistent ping times that disrupt your activities.

Troubleshooting Common Issues

If your speed test Google Wifi results are disappointing, there are specific troubleshooting steps to follow. Often, the issue is simply the placement of the nodes; they should be spaced roughly 1-2 rooms apart without being blocked by dense walls or metal objects. Furthermore, ensuring your primary unit is connected via Ethernet to the modem eliminates a significant source of slowdown, allowing the satellite nodes to function at their peak capability.

The Role of Wired Backhaul

One of the most significant factors in maximizing your speed test Google Wifi results is the implementation of a wired backhaul. While wireless systems are convenient, connecting the nodes using Ethernet cables allows data to travel at full speed without the interference of radio waves. If your home is pre-wired for Ethernet, taking advantage of this feature transforms your mesh network from a good system to a great one, offering near-gigabit speeds to every device.

When to Consider an Upgrade or Supplement

Technology evolves rapidly, and the hardware you purchased years ago may not handle the current demands of 5G internet and smart homes. If you consistently fail to reach even 50% of your subscribed speed after troubleshooting, it may be time to upgrade your hardware. Alternatively, adding a single dedicated access point or a powerline adapter can fill specific gaps in coverage that the standard Google Wifi configuration cannot address efficiently.
